| 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071 |
- import {
- request
- } from '@/utils/request'
- // 获取保养工单统计数量
- export function getMaintenanceCount(params) {
- return request({
- url: '/rq/stat/maintenance/total',
- method: 'get',
- params
- })
- }
- // 获取保养工单列表
- export function getMaintenanceList(params) {
- return request({
- url: '/pms/iot-main-work-order/sortedMainWorkOrderPage',
- // url: '/pms/iot-main-work-order/page',
- method: 'get',
- params
- })
- }
- // 根据设备id获取设备保养项
- export function getDeviceAssociateBomList(params) {
- return request({
- url: '/rq/iot-device/deviceAssociateBomList',
- method: 'get',
- params
- })
- }
- // 保存保养工单
- export function saveMaintenance(data) {
- return request({
- url: '/pms/iot-main-work-order/addWorkOrder',
- method: 'put',
- data
- })
- }
- // 查询保养工单详情
- export function getMaintenanceDetail(params) {
- return request({
- url: '/pms/iot-main-work-order/get',
- method: 'get',
- params
- })
- }
- // 查询保养工单详情 - 保养工单明细BOM列表
- export function getWorkOrderBOMs(params) {
- return request({
- url: '/pms/iot-main-work-order-bom/getWorkOrderBOMs',
- method: 'get',
- params
- })
- }
- // 填报保养工单
- export function fillWorkOrder(data) {
- return request({
- url: '/pms/iot-main-work-order/fillWorkOrder',
- method: 'put',
- data
- })
- }
- // 查询保养工单已经选择的所有物料
- export function getBomMaterialsByWorkOrderId(params) {
- return request({
- url: '/pms/iot-main-work-order-bom-material/list',
- method: 'get',
- params
- })
- }
|